The Details
Open your C: drive (or whatever directory you have steam installed to)
Open Program Files (x86)
Open steam folder
Open steamapps folder
Open workshop folder
Open content folder
Find the folder that has your ATS mods (in my case folder “270880”)
Find the folder for each respective engine mod (every mod should have a “mod_description” text file)
Once found, open def > vehicle > trucks
Copy “peterbilt.579” folder
Rename the copy “peterbilt.389” witho/ quotations
Open 389 folder and find “mx” or “isx12” text files then open them in notepad
Same as renaming the folder, change line section “isx12.peterbilt.579.engine” (or mx depending on which engine mod) to “isx12.peterbilt.389.engine” witho/ quotations
IMPORTANT: use File Save, not File Save as
Close all windows after everything is saved
Launch ATS and confirm that the engine mods are active in your load order
